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Lamphun, Thailand

Wat Haripunchai

Wat Haripunchai is Lamphun's most iconic landmark, a magnificent temple showcasing stunning architecture and a rich history. Explore its serene grounds, admire the intricate details of its structures, and soak in the spiritual atmosphere. It's a must-see for any visitor to Lamphun.

Lamphun National Museum

Delve into the fascinating history of Lamphun at the Lamphun National Museum. Discover ancient artifacts, learn about the city's rich past, and gain a deeper understanding of its cultural significance. The museum offers a captivating journey through time.

Chedi Sao

This ancient brick chedi (stupa) is a testament to Lamphun's enduring legacy. Chedi Sao, with its unique architectural style, stands as a symbol of the city's historical importance and offers a glimpse into its ancient past. Its serene atmosphere makes it a perfect spot for contemplation.

Best Time to Visit Lamphun, Thailand

The best time to visit Lamphun is during the cooler, dry season, from November to April. The weather is pleasant, and the crowds are generally smaller than during the peak tourist season. However, be aware that some festivals may occur during other times of the year.

Transportation Options in Lamphun, Thailand

Getting around Lamphun is relatively easy. Songthaews (red trucks) are readily available for short trips within the city and to nearby areas. Renting a bicycle is a great way to explore the surrounding countryside at your own pace.
